Risks of Alzheimer’s Disease

Associated Diseases and Their Risks: Alzheimer’s disease predominantly affects older adults, manifesting as memory loss, cognitive decline, and behavioral changes. As the disease advances, patients may become fully reliant on caregivers, profoundly affecting their daily life.

Complications of Alzheimer’s Disease

  1. Cognitive Decline Deterioration in memory, judgment, and language skills.
  2. Behavioral and Personality Changes Manifestations of anxiety, depression, and aggression.
  3. Loss of Independence Challenges in managing daily activities and personal care.
  4. Physical Health Deterioration Decreased mobility, compromised nutrition, and heightened susceptibility to infections.

Symptoms of Alzheimer’s Disease

Memory Loss - An inability to recall recent events or conversations.
- Frequent forgetting of important dates or appointments
Cognitive Impairment - Challenges in solving problems and planning tasks
- Difficulties with routine activities.
Language Decline - Trouble finding the right words and expressing thoughts
- Repetitive questioning and evident confusion during conversations.
Disorientation in Time and Space - Confusion regarding the current time, date, or location.
- Instances of getting lost in familiar surroundings
Behavioral and Personality Changes - Increased incidences of anxiety, depression, or aggression.
- Withdrawal from social interactions and activities
